Bug 8336 - Stage participants has visibility problems
Stage participants has visibility problems
Status: NEW
Product: OMP
Classification: Unclassified
Component: User Interface
1.1.1
All All
: P3 normal
Assigned To: Michael Thessel
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2013-07-25 09:12 PDT by beghelli
Modified: 2014-10-17 19:25 PDT (History)
2 users (show)

See Also:
Version Reported In:
Also Affects: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description beghelli 2013-07-25 09:12:54 PDT
When the grid doesn't fit entirely inside the pkp_structure_main div (see non initiated review stage, for example) the part of the grid that's outside the div is not visible.

This is caused by the overflow:hidden css rule defined for the pkp_structure_main div. But removing this will break the side bar arrangement. I sense that we need to solve the side bars markup and styles to fix this one.
Comment 1 Alec Smecher 2013-07-25 13:14:52 PDT
Do you have a rough idea what this would look like, Bruno? The sidebar styles are pretty unrefined, so I don't think a rewrite will be disruptive.
Comment 2 Michael Thessel 2014-10-17 19:25:11 PDT
Hi Bruno,

I have been looking into this. What behavior would you expect? We could do a media query approach where we hide/reposition/restructure the sidebar. 

Generally speaking though:
The site generally looks fine for screens 1000px and higher. If we want to have it look good below that we are basically talking about creating a responsive theme. I'm not sure how necessary that is in our case. Do we have evidence that a significant number of people uses our site with screens smaller than 1000px width?

If we just fix the sidebar issue we look pretty good for screens down to 750px. That said I don't think that there are many devices out there that would benefit just from that optimization. Let me know what you think.